Express 1.2 km as a percentage of 300 m

Answers

Answer:

1.2km is 400% of 300m

Step-by-step explanation:

1 km=1000m

So,1.2 km=1000*1.2=1200m

Let 1.2km(or 1200m) be x% of 300 m

By the problem,

300*x/100 = 1200

Or, 3x=1200

Or,x=1200/3=400

1.2km is 400% of 300m

In a ABC shown below, side AC is extended to point D with m Z DAB= (180 – 3x) °, mZ B= (6x – 40) °, and m ZC = (x+20) °.
Whats the measure of angle BAC?

Answers

Answer:

60°

Step-by-step explanation:

Given :

DAB= (180 – 3x) °,

mZ B= (6x – 40) °, and

m ZC = (x+20) °.

DAB = mZ B + m ZC ( the exterior angle equal the sum of the two opposite interior angles)

180 - 3x = (6x - 40) + (x + 20)

180 - 3x = 6x - 40 + x + 20

180 - 3x = 6x + x - 40 + 20

180 - 3x = 7x - 20

180 + 20 = 7x + 3x

200 = 10x

x = 200/10

x = 20

Angle B = 6x - 40 = 6(20) - 40 = 120 - 40 = 80

Angle C = x + 20 = 20 + 20 = 40

BAC = 180 - (80 + 40) (SUM OF ANGLES IN A TRIANGLE)

BAC = 180 - 120

BAC = 60°
